Outdoor Experiences That Reflect the Region
Sonoma and Marin guests come for the outdoors. Properties that lean into this win. A well-designed fire pit area with comfortable seating, quality firewood, and s'mores supplies costs relatively little but gets mentioned in reviews constantly. An outdoor kitchen with a proper grill, prep space, and dining area turns a backyard into a destination. Hot tubs remain one of the highest-ROI amenities in our market, particularly for properties that can position them with a view.
For properties near the coast or Russian River, water toys like kayaks, paddleboards, or even a small boat dock access can be the deciding factor for a booking. Beach essentials like quality chairs, umbrellas, a cooler, and a wagon for hauling gear to the sand are low-cost touches that guests genuinely appreciate.
Local Partnerships That Add Real Value
The most memorable amenity isn't always something you install. It's something you arrange. Partnerships with local wineries for private tastings, with local guides for hiking or kayaking tours, or with area restaurants for priority reservations give guests access to experiences they couldn't easily arrange themselves. These partnerships cost little to set up and add significant perceived value to your listing.
A curated welcome basket featuring products from local Sonoma or Marin makers, a bottle of wine from a nearby vineyard, or a bag of beans from a local roaster signals that you know the area and care about the guest experience. These touches get photographed and shared.
Workspace Amenities for the Modern Traveler
The line between work and vacation has blurred permanently. Properties that accommodate remote work without making it feel like an office command longer stays and higher rates. A dedicated desk with a comfortable chair, good lighting, a fast and reliable connection, and a clean background for video calls is now a meaningful differentiator. Properties that highlight these features in their listings see measurably longer average stays.
Wellness Touches That Don't Require Major Investment
You don't need to install a sauna to appeal to wellness-minded travelers (though if you can, it's worth it). Quality yoga mats, a foam roller, and a set of resistance bands in a dedicated corner of a room signal that you've thought about this. A soaking tub with quality bath products, a steam shower, or even a cold plunge setup on a deck can become the headline amenity that drives bookings.
Premium bedding is one of the highest-impact investments you can make. High thread-count sheets, quality pillows, and a plush duvet are mentioned in positive reviews more than almost any other amenity. Guests sleep better and remember it.
Entertainment That Brings Groups Together
For properties that target groups and families, entertainment amenities drive bookings. A well-stocked game room with a pool table, ping pong, or foosball gives guests a reason to stay in and enjoy the property. A projector setup for outdoor movie nights, a quality sound system, or a poker table for a group weekend all create the kind of shared experiences that lead to repeat bookings and referrals.
Board games, card games, and puzzles are low-cost additions that guests consistently mention in reviews. They signal that you've thought about what guests actually do during a stay, not just where they sleep.
The Amenity Audit
Before adding anything new, walk through your property as a guest would. What's missing? What would make the first hour easier? What would make the last night more enjoyable? The answers are usually simpler and less expensive than you'd expect.
